1 1/2 cups dry cannelinni beans
3 cups water and dry chicken broth --- to strength you like
1 tblsp oil
3 chicken tenders
1 onion, chopped
1/8th bell pepper
1/2 cup of water
1/2 pkg McCormick's white gravy mix
1/3 pack Mccormick's mild chili mix
Cook beans until almost done and then transfer to crock pot and turn on low.
Chop your onion and bell pepper, and put in a skillet with the oil. Begin to saute, do not have to brown. Season your chicken tenders, and add them to the pan with the onions and peppers. Brown on both sides.
Remove chicken and chop and return to pan. Mix water, gravy mix and chili mix, pour over chicken and veggies. Let cook for 1-3 minutes. Then pour all into crock pot with beans. Turn crock pot onto high, and cook for about 30 minutes.
Serve with some crusty bread. I think we all know how crusty bread enhances soup --- of any kind!
